Abstract
Two independent calculations have been carried out to obtain the integ ral cross sections for the excitation of n = 2 and 3 states from the g roundstate of hydrogen at electron impact energies lying between n = 3 and n = 4 thresholds. The first is the 15-state R-matrix calculation of Fon er al and the second is the algebraic variation method of Wang and Callaway. It is shown that in this energy range the contribution o f the ionization continuum to the excitation cross sections is estimat ed to range from 12 to 15%, and that the convergent J-matrix results o f Konovalov and McCarthy have not yet completely converged.
